actually we have a reverse zone-file (class B) such as
19.172.in-addr.arpa which contains multiple (ca. 24) class C-networks.
Everything is working fine with ms 2003 and 2k Server in an Active
Directory environment but the registration of the famous [;-)] ILO
(inside light out) boards do fail.

They want to add their PTR-Records in the /24 domain and no where else,
so they get NOT AUTH.

Nevertheless our sysadmins requested me to split the domains in /24 zones.

So my question is how to split the zone? Has someone developed a script
(perl or shell) to do so? Is there maybe an alternative way?
